From c3779d8513dbb1d80d29132aaf1550080c07dda7 Mon Sep 17 00:00:00 2001 From: Romain Vimont Date: Fri, 24 May 2019 17:24:17 +0200 Subject: [PATCH] Make owned serial a pointer-to-non-const The file handler owns the serial, so it needs to free it. Therefore, it should not be a pointer-to-const. --- app/src/file_handler.c | 2 +- app/src/file_handler.h |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/app/src/file_handler.c b/app/src/file_handler.c index e9d5e02b..c4366691 100644 --- a/app/src/file_handler.c +++ b/app/src/file_handler.c @@ -121,7 +121,7 @@ file_handler_destroy(struct file_handler *file_handler) { SDL_DestroyCond(file_handler->event_cond); SDL_DestroyMutex(file_handler->mutex); request_queue_destroy(&file_handler->queue); - SDL_free((void *) file_handler->serial); + SDL_free(file_handler->serial); } static process_t diff --git a/app/src/file_handler.h b/app/src/file_handler.h index 111161dc..5d50289d 100644 --- a/app/src/file_handler.h +++ b/app/src/file_handler.h @@ -21,7 +21,7 @@ struct request_queue { }; struct file_handler { - const char *serial; + char *serial; SDL_Thread *thread; SDL_mutex *mutex; SDL_cond *event_cond;